Course Details
• Arts Advocacy Fundamentals: Understanding the importance of arts advocacy, the role of partnership building, and the basics of effective communication. • Identifying Stakeholders: Recognizing key players in the arts advocacy landscape, including policymakers, community leaders, and arts organizations. • Building Successful Partnerships: Strategies for creating and maintaining effective partnerships, including collaborative goal-setting, communication, and trust-building. • Influencing Policy: Techniques for impacting policy decisions, including research, lobbying, and grassroots organizing. • Community Engagement: Methods for engaging community members, including outreach, education, and events. • Evaluating Partnership Success: Metrics for measuring partnership impact, including data collection, analysis, and reporting. • Diversity, Equity, and Inclusion: Strategies for promoting diversity, equity, and inclusion in arts advocacy partnerships. • Sustainable Funding Models: Approaches for securing sustainable funding, including grants, donations, and earned income. • Case Studies in Arts Advocacy Partnership Building: Analysis of successful arts advocacy partnerships and the lessons learned.
